SAFETY MANAGER

Memphis, TN, United States

**Job Details**

**SAFETY MANAGER - (63334)**

This details all the information about the job posting. ABM (NYSE: ABM) is a leading provider of facility solutions with revenues of approximately $6.4 billion and over 130,000 employees in 300+ offices deployed throughout the United States and various international locations. ABMs comprehensive capabilities include electrical & lighting, energy solutions, facilities engineering, HVAC & mechanical, janitorial, landscape & turf, mission critical solutions and parking, provided through stand-alone or integrated solutions. Founded in 1909, ABM provides custom facility solutions in urban, suburban and rural areas to properties of all sizes from schools and commercial buildings to hospitals, data centers, manufacturing plants and airports. Job Title SAFETY MANAGER Education Bachelor's Degree Career Level Manager Category Operations Job Type/ FLSA Status Salaried Exempt Travel Required None Shift Type N/A Job Description Core Responsibilities: Site Specific-DOT & EHS Duties

Responsible for communicating company policies in a consistent manner with a key focus on incident prevention and loss abatement.

Conduct on-site risk assessments to identify potential hazards.

Conduct accident investigations and recommend corrective/preventive actions.

Determine status of DOT & EHS accidents and ensure all incidents are appropriately reported.

Ensure ABM compliance to USDOT/FMCSA, OSHA & state authorities, and company policies.

Ensure the proper branding of company vehicles with USDOT/FMCSA identifications.

Maintain a driver qualification program (DQ files) to ensure that drivers fully comply with all regulations, including Drug/Alcohol Program. Conduct annual & periodic review of all driver files/DQ files to include but not limited to MVR, annual review, accident review, camera events (i.e.: Lytx), periodic reviews and all other required Driver qualifications to USDOT/FMCSA, & ABM standards.

Maintain all JJ Keller files and ensure 100% compliance within a timely manner as well as addressing any alerts of pending or found files having corrective action items.

Ensure timely notification to HR, Site Manager & ABM DOT Director of any/all positive D/A tests.

Train, educate, monitor, and manage driver safety performance and compliance.

Conducts/leads all new hire driver & support staff training as well as updates DOT/EHS programs.

Conducts all road tests of DOT & non-DOT drivers.

Ensure maintenance records and reports for DOT, OSHA and Compliance are current.

Guide and coordinate with site maintenance bus & other assigned vehicle compliance.

Analyze vehicle accidents data, to include in cab cameras i.e.: Lytx. Assign/coach each event within 10 days to ABM established/approved policy as set forth by ABM DOT Risk & Safety Director and HR.

Lead regularly scheduled safety meetings to determine the effectiveness of safety and accident prevention activities, and to ensure compliance with all applicable safety directives.

Responsible for the DOT & occupational health, safety, and loss control management of the site.

Responsible for providing health and safety support of the company's policies to include accident, workmans compensation and required EHS reports i.e.: COVID-19 compliance/internal reporting.

Responsible for evaluating, training, and complying to safety & health initiatives that will ensure a safe, healthy, and accident-free environment.

Will report directly to the Site Account Manager for day-to-day activities and report dotted line into the Regional EHS Manager. DOT duties specifically related to USDOT/FMCSA Compliance i.e.: D&A, DQ file, updates and reporting will continue to be reported dotted line into the ABM DOT Risk & Safety Director.

Minimum Requirements Bachelors degree in Business, Safety Management, Safety Engineering, Occupational Safety or EH&S related degree is required. Proficiency in Microsoft, PowerPoint, Word, Excel. Proficient knowledge of OSHA CFR 1910 and CFR 1926 regulations. EHS & DOT experience is required. Must have a minimum of five years safety experience. Skilled in communicating ideas and instructions clearly. Strong organization skills.
